This is an official announcement from the Big-8 Management Board.

In response to concerns regarding the lack of a formal quorum rule in
the internal Board voting policies, especially in regards to the use of
explicit abstentions, the Board has updated our voting rules to add three
sub-points to Rule 9:

  9.  Issue votes are won by a simple majority of votes cast, not counting 
      abstentions.

   I.   A vote requires at least half of the active members voting or 
        explicitly abstaining in order to be decisive.
   II.  If a vote is not decisive, the issue remains undecided, and options 
        such as further debate, tabling the issue, or altering the question 
        being voted upon may be pursued.
   III. Members are encouraged to abstain only in exceptional circumstances, 
        but each member is free to use his/her judgment to determine when 
        abstention is appropriate.
